Dr. Erik J. Sontheimer's lab focuses on developing cutting-edge genetic editing technologies to treat diseases, specifically frontotemporal dementia caused by granulin mutations. The team uses precision genome editing techniques like base and prime editing to accurately correct genetic mutations in neuronal cells and evaluate their effectiveness in mouse models. This innovative approach aims to create safer and more effective therapies for neurological disorders that currently lack treatment options.
